The nylon monofilament market has witnessed steady growth over the past decade, driven by the material's versatility and wide range of applications. Nylon monofilament is a single, continuous strand of synthetic fiber known for its strength, elasticity, and resistance to abrasion and chemicals. It is widely used in industries such as fishing, textiles, agriculture, filtration, and medical sectors. The unique combination of mechanical properties and adaptability makes nylon monofilament a preferred choice over other synthetic fibers. Over the years, manufacturers have focused on innovation in monofilament production, enhancing both performance and efficiency to cater to growing industrial demands.

Drivers

Several factors are driving the growth of the nylon monofilament market. The foremost driver is its extensive use in the fishing industry. Nylon monofilament fishing lines are preferred for their superior tensile strength, elasticity, and resistance to wear, making them indispensable for both commercial and recreational fishing. Similarly, the agricultural sector is increasingly relying on nylon monofilament for applications such as crop protection nets, greenhouse structures, and trellises due to its durability and weather resistance.

The textile industry also contributes significantly to market growth. Nylon monofilament is employed in industrial fabrics, hosiery, and netting due to its fine diameter, uniformity, and high mechanical strength. The rising demand from these end-use industries is expected to maintain a positive growth trajectory for the market in the coming years. Additionally, the medical and healthcare sector is increasingly utilizing nylon monofilament in surgical sutures and other biomedical applications, further propelling market expansion.

Restraints

Despite its many advantages, the nylon monofilament market faces certain challenges. High production costs, especially for high-grade nylon monofilament with specialized properties, can restrict widespread adoption in cost-sensitive markets. Additionally, the environmental concerns associated with synthetic polymers present a restraint. As governments and consumers worldwide push for sustainable and biodegradable alternatives, traditional nylon products may face regulatory and social pressures.

Another significant restraint is the competition from alternative materials such as polyester, polyethylene, and biodegradable polymers. These substitutes offer comparable performance at competitive prices, which may impact the market share of nylon monofilament, especially in regions where cost-efficiency is critical.

Segmentations

The nylon monofilament market can be segmented based on type, application, and region. By type, it is classified into nylon 6 and nylon 66, with nylon 6 dominating due to its balance of strength, flexibility, and cost-effectiveness. Nylon 66 is preferred in high-performance applications that demand higher thermal stability and tensile strength.

By application, the market spans industries such as fishing, textiles, agriculture, filtration, medical, and industrial uses. Fishing and textile applications constitute the largest share, owing to their consistent demand for high-quality monofilament fibers. In agriculture, nylon monofilament is increasingly utilized for nets, twines, and crop protection structures due to its long service life and resistance to environmental stress. Filtration applications also contribute significantly, with nylon monofilament being employed in water treatment plants, air filters, and industrial filtration systems.

Challenges and Market Constraints

The nylon monofilament market faces challenges related to raw material volatility and fluctuating prices of nylon intermediates such as caprolactam. Supply chain disruptions can affect production schedules, impacting the availability and pricing of finished monofilament products. Additionally, stringent environmental regulations concerning non-biodegradable polymers can hinder market growth, especially in regions with rigorous plastic waste management policies.

Another challenge is the need for consistent quality and performance across different production batches. Industrial applications such as filtration and medical sutures demand high precision and reliability, putting pressure on manufacturers to maintain stringent quality control standards.
